Police nab man for allegedly impregnating own daughter,tries aborting pregnancy

AdminBy AdminApril 29, 2022No Comments1 Min Read
Spread the love

By Correspondent in Akure.

The Police Command in Ondo state says it has arrest a 38-year-old father, Sunday Udoh,or allegedly impregnating his own daughter and trying to abort the daughter’s pregnancy.

The Police Public Relations Officer,(PPRO) for the Police Command in the state, SP Odunlami Funmilayo, said the suspect was arrested when trying to abort the pregnancy at Ile Oluji,Ondo state.

The PPRO says: “On 26th of April, 2022, Policemen attached to Ile-Oluji Division received a complaint of an attempt to procure abortion by one Sunday Udoh ‘m’, Aged 38, at a health care centre in Ile-Oluji.

“During investigation, it was revealed that the suspect was attempting to procure abortion for her daughter (Name withheld) of about 15 years old, whom he has been been having sexual intercourse with.

“The case is currently being handled by the Gender Office of the State Criminal Investigation Department in Akure.”
